In a refreshingly absurd departure from the traditional gravitas of the insurance sector, NJM leans into deadpan comedy with its latest public awareness spot, Chomps. The project, produced by Sweet Rickey, centers on a mundane office break room setting that is quickly upended by the surreal arrival of a mascot dressed as a football-loving brown dog. By juxtaposing a clean, commercial aesthetic with the chaotic spectacle of a costumed character dumping kibble across a boardroom table, the campaign uses humor to break the pattern of standard industry messaging. The live-action technique is executed with surgical precision, utilizing high-key lighting to emphasize the jarring contrast between the office employees’ confusion and the mascot’s unbothered, enthusiastic dining habits. This lifestyle-focused narrative relies on the power of visual disruption to capture attention in an otherwise saturated market. By sidestepping overly formal tropes, the agency crafts a memorable, lighthearted moment that prioritizes engagement over exposition. The result is a bold, polished piece of creative storytelling that proves the non-profit and public awareness space can successfully embrace eccentric character-driven content to reach a broader audience, turning a simple product-adjacent gag into an effective instrument of brand differentiation that feels both sharp and inherently watchable for the modern consumer.
